Salt, the Silent Killer: Benefits of Reducing Salt in Your Diet

Salt is a common ingredient in almost all types of cuisines. However, it is also a leading cause of several health problems, including hypertension, heart disease, and stroke. While salt is an essential nutrient required for the proper functioning of the body, excessive consumption of salt can be harmful.
